There has been a shift in recent years to embrace fatness as a disease and in fact, the American Medical Association did do just that in 2013, against advice from many experts. Is the premise of larger body sizes as inherently "diseased" helpful? What about "ob*sity" doctors who advocate for the use of a person's first language? Is that shift going to end the stigma for fat people? Let's talk about it!
